Headquarters, 82d Airborne Division, General Orders No. 64 (May 11, 1945)
The President of the United States of America, authorized by Act of Congress July 9, 1918, takes pleasure in presenting the Silver Star to Sergeant Thomas P. Reiley (ASN: RA-6070125), United States Army, for gallantry in action while serving with the 74th Tank Battalion, 82d Airborne Division, in action on 2 February 1945, near *****, Germany. During the advance the tank platoon came under enemy tank and anti-tank fire which knocked out two tanks. Sergeant Reiley’s tank and the two remaining tanks went into defilade behind a building. Sergeant Reiley’s tank was the most exposed but remained in this position in order to cover the remaining two tanks. His tank received eight hits by enemy 88 shells which killed one, seriously wounded another of the crew, and blew Sergeant Reiley out of his tank. Despite the enemy mortar and artillery fire and his own wounds, Sergeant Reiley re-mounted his tank and evacuated the seriously wounded crew member to shelter and secured medical aid for him. Sergeant Reiley’s gallant action is in keeping with the highest traditions of the United States Army.
